FAMILY STRENGTHENING AND YOUTH GUIDANCE DAY
May 26, 2026
As part of the Municipal Intervention Program under Oplan Bata for Children at Risk (CAR) and Children in Conflict with the Law (CICL), the Family Strengthening and Youth Guidance Day was successfully conducted on May 26, 2026, with the active participation of both minors and their parents or guardians.
The one-day activity aimed to strengthen family relationships, promote responsible behavior among the youth, and enhance parental involvement in the development and guidance of their children. The program featured a series of symposiums and seminars covering important topics such as the Curfew Ordinance and Child Protection Laws, Family Strengthening, and Spiritual and Values Formation. A Parenting Seminar was also conducted to equip parents with effective parenting strategies and reinforce their vital role in nurturing responsible and law-abiding children.
For the youth participants, a Life Skills Workshop was facilitated, focusing on Decision-Making Skills and Peer Pressure Management, enabling them to make informed choices and resist negative influences. To further strengthen family bonds and encourage teamwork, a Joint Parent-Child Team Building Activity was conducted, fostering cooperation, trust, communication, and mutual understanding among participants.
The activity served as an avenue for learning, reflection, and family engagement, supporting the municipality's commitment to child protection, youth development, and the rehabilitation and reintegration of CAR and CICL into the community.
